On Tuesday night the GOP swept the special election races in North Carolina.
Republican Greg Murphy won North Carolina’s 3rd Congressional District by over 20 points.
Republican Dan Bishop came from 15 points down to win North Carolina’s 9th Congressional District by 2 points.
What is even more remarkable is how big the wins were.
In district 9 Dan Bishop won Robeson County in the eastern part of the district.
According to J. Miles Coleman just last year the county went to the Democrat by 15 points.
On Tuesday Bishop nearly flipped the county. Democrat McCready only won the county by 1 point!
